1️⃣ Common Causes of Neck Pain

Neck pain often develops from everyday habits and posture. Common causes include poor posture, long hours sitting, stress and tension, whiplash injuries, and weak core muscles. These small habits may not seem serious, but over time they can lead to chronic stiffness, tension headaches, and fatigue.

4️⃣ How to Prevent Neck Pain at Home

Keep your screen at eye level to prevent hunching, take short stretch breaks every 30–45 minutes, sleep with a supportive pillow, and stay active. Even small changes like adjusting your workstation or adding a few minutes of stretching can prevent tension from building up.

5️⃣ When to See a Chiropractor

If neck pain lasts more than a few days, spreads to your shoulders or arms, or starts causing headaches or tingling, it’s time to seek care.
